Preparing the Lettuce Cups
The first step in our lettuce wrap journey is to get our lettuce ready. You’ll want to carefully detach the leaves from the head of romaine lettuce. Gently rinse them under cool water and pat them dry with a clean kitchen towel or paper towels. This is important to ensure the crispness of the lettuce. For easier handling and eating, you can either break larger leaves into more manageable pieces or slice them in half horizontally. The goal is to have sturdy, boat-like vessels for our flavorful chicken filling. Set these aside and keep them cool while you prepare the filling.
Cooking the Savory Chicken Filling
Now, let’s build the heart of our dish – the delicious chicken filling. Heat 1 tablespoon of sesame o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Once the oil is shimmering, add the ground chicken. Break up the chicken with a spoon and cook until it’s browned and cooked through, which usually takes about 5-7 minutes. Drain off any excess grease.
Next, add the diced shallot and the white parts of the sliced scallions to the skillet. Cook for another 2-3 minutes until they start to soften and become fragrant. This aromatic base is crucial for developing deep flavor.
Now, it’s time to introduce the star vegetables. Add the diced shiitake mushrooms and the drained and diced water chestnuts to the skillet. Stir everything together and cook for about 5 minutes, or until the mushrooms have softened and released some of their moisture. The water chestnuts will add a wonderful textural contrast with their slight crunch.
In a small bowl, whisk together the hoisin sauce, low-sodium soy sauce, regular soy sauce, rice vinegar, and the remaining 1/2 tablespoon of sesame oil. This creates our flavorful sauce. Pour this sauce over the chicken and vegetable mixture in the skillet. Add the minced garlic and grated gin extractger. Stir well to ensure everything is evenly coated.
Simmering and Finishing the Filling
Continue to cook the mixture for another 3-5 minutes, stirring occasionally. We want the sauce to thicken slightly and the flavors to meld together beautifully. The aroma at this stage is incredible! Before you turn off the heat, stir in the green parts of the sliced scallions. These will add a fresh, bright oniony flavor and a lovely pop of color. Taste the filling and adjust seasonings if necessary. You might want a little more soy sauce for saltiness or a touch more rice vinegar for tang.
Assembling and Serving
To serve, spoon a generous portion of the hot chicken filling into each prepared lettuce cup. You can either present the filling and lettuce separately, allowing everyone to build their own, or you can pre-fill the lettuce cups for a more elegant presentation. These are best enjoyed immediately while the filling is warm and the lettuce is crisp. Some people enjoy adding a drizzle of sriracha or a sprinkle of chopped peanuts for extra flavor and texture, but they are truly perfect just as they are. Enjoy this taste of PF Chang’s at home!

Q: Can I make the chicken filling ahead of time?
Absolutely! The chicken filling can be made up to 2 days in advance and st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Reheat it gently on the stovetop or in the microwave before serving. This makes assembly even quicker!
Q: What kind of lettuce is best for lettuce wraps?
Iceberg lettuce is the classic choice for its sturdy, cup-like leaves that hold the filling well. However, butter lettuce (also known as Boston or Bibb lettuce) also works beautifully and offers a slightly softer texture.

PF Chang’s Chicken Lettuce Wraps
Savory ground chicken filling seasoned with Asian-inspired flavors, served in crisp romaine lettuce cups. A popular appetizer or light meal.
Ingredients
-
1 tbsp sesame oil
-
1 lb ground chicken
-
1 (8 oz) can water chestnuts, drained and diced
-
3 oz shiitake mushrooms, diced
-
3 scallions, thinly sliced
-
1 head of romaine lettuce, leaves washed and broken or sliced in half horizontally
-
1/4 cup hoisin sauce
-
1 tbsp low-sodium soy sauce
-
1 tbsp regular soy sauce
-
1 tbsp rice vinegar
-
1/2 tbsp sesame oil
-
2 tsp lightly packed fresh grated ginger
-
3 garlic cloves, minced
-
1 shallot, diced
Instructions
-
Step 1
Heat 1 tbsp sesame o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. -
Step 2
Add ground chicken to the skillet and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ned and cooked through. Drain off any excess grease. -
Step 3
Add diced water chestnuts, shiitake mushrooms, minced garlic, minced ginger, and diced shallot to the skillet with the chicken. Cook for 2-3 minutes until fragrant and softened. -
Step 4
In a small bowl, whisk together hoisin sauce, low-sodium soy sauce, regular soy sauce, and rice vinegar. -
Step 5
Pour the sauce mixture over the chicken and vegetable mixture in the skillet. Stir to combine and cook for another 1-2 minutes until the sauce has thickened slightly. -
Step 6
Stir in 1/2 tbsp sesame oil and most of the thinly sliced scallions. Reserve some scallions for garnish. -
Step 7
Serve the chicken mixture in individual romaine lettuce cups. Garnish with the reserved sliced scallions.
